Program Management

Board of Directors: Comprised of distinguished former state and federal regulators plus industry representatives, the Board is responsible for governing ESAC and establishing its standards and procedures with assistance from ESAC's Industry Advisory Board. The Board receives additional support from its legal and accounting advisors and service providers.

Industry Advisory Board: Established by NAPEO in 1999, the IAB is composed of a broad industry representation of all areas of the country and all sizes and types of PEOs. The IAB's mission is to enhance public trust and acceptance of the PEO industry and to achieve more favorable and uniform treatment by regulators nationwide by helping to improve ESAC's programs and related industry participation in self-regulation.

Staff: ESAC's services are provided by a full-time staff consisting of ESAC's Chairman, Executive Director, and Service Coordinator.
